Obai Ismail (better known as 451) is a British artist, songwriter, and record producer from London, United Kingdom.

His stage name was derived from the dystopian novel Fahrenheit 451 by American writer Ray Bradbury, first published in 1953.

451 released his debut project Couleur on October 26, 2018. The EP consists of eight tracks, three of which have been released as a single. Featuring on the EP is Toronto artist SAFE. Executive produced by Mark Cruz and Sam Fresh.

In September 2020, he started dropping singles for his sophomore project Night Vision and released the mixtape on March 5, 2021. It came along highly anticipated records like “Nobu No More” or Fall’s Profit Freestyle".
